Original Description
Oluf Hartmann’s Daedalus and Icarus captures the poignant moment of Greek myth with arresting emotional depth. The painting, likely inspired by the classical tale of hubris and tragedy, blends symbolic realism with soft, almost dreamlike brushwork, reflecting Hartmann’s academic training and Nordic sensitivity to light. Warm, golden hues envelop Icarus mid-flight, contrasting with the cooler tones of the sea below—a visual metaphor for aspiration and consequence. Though less renowned than Bruegel’s or Leighton’s renditions, Hartmann’s version stands out for its intimate, melancholic atmosphere, bridging 19th-century Romanticism and emerging Symbolism. Its historical significance lies in its reinterpretation of a universal narrative through a distinctly Scandinavian lens, making it a subtle yet compelling piece in art history’s conversations about myth and human folly.
